数据库-小型餐饮管理系统.pdf
--
苏州科技学院
电子与信息工程学院
《数据库原理课程设计》报告
学ﻩﻩ号1430107130
姓ﻩﻩ名郑宏艳
班级1421
ﻩ日ﻩﻩ期2015年12月
一、任务及要求:
小型餐饮管理系统
主要功能:餐饮消费查询、餐饮消费更新、餐饮消费统计、餐饮消费会员管理
二、数据库设计:(要求叙述数据库设计的过程,画出E-R图,列出数据库
中的表名称及结构,并说明表间的关系)
(1)E—R图:
--
--
(2)实体模型:
我的报告总共两个表,第一个表是会员表(会员id,会员密
码,会员姓名,会员电话,收款金额,会员性别等),第二个表是
菜单管理表(菜单名称,菜单价格,食物照片,配料,功效)
ruser(会员表)
food(食谱表)
序号字段名称字段描述字段类型长度备注
1User_id会员账号Nvarcharr20不允许空
2Pass会员密码Nvarch20不允许空
codear
3Name会员姓名Nvarchar20不允许空
4Phone会员电话Nvarcha20不允许空
r
5Money收款金额Money10不允许空
6Sex会员性别Nvarchar4允许空
序号字段名称字段描述字段类型长度备注
1Name食谱名称Nvarch20不允许空
ar
--
2Price价格Nvarchar10不允许空
--
三、实现的功能及相应的界面和代码:
1.连接数据库的实现
(1)首先实现数据库的连接,代码如下所示:
SqlConnectionconn=newSqlConnection();
conn.ConnectionString=datasource=RONGER-PC\\SQLEXPRESS;initial
Catalog=小型餐馆;userid=123;password=123;
conn.Open();
conn.Close();
conn.Dispose();
(2)链接数据库,后台取的数据库菜单列表的所有数据,在页面前台进行展示
视图展现:
代码的实现: